Once your image is ready, follow these steps to apply it to your Pro system: anywhere on your desktop. Select Personalize from the menu. Under the Background dropdown, choose "Picture." Click Browse and select your 1920x1200 file.

💡 : If you want a dynamic look, put several 1920x1200 images into one folder. In the Background settings, select Slideshow and choose that folder to have your wallpaper rotate automatically. : Always start your canvas at 1920x1200
